Winde oder normales Servo

Ich versuche einen Roboterarm zu bauen und für die Basis brauche ich ein Servo mit viel Drehmoment. Nachdem ich die Servoauswahl von Hobbyking durchgesehen hatte, bemerkte ich, dass Windenservos ein höheres Drehmoment zu einem allgemein niedrigeren Preis bieten, aber ich habe keine Erfahrung mit deren Verwendung.

Bevor ich mich dazu entschließe, viel Geld für möglicherweise falsche Servos für mein Projekt auszugeben, weiß jemand, ob es ein Problem geben würde, ein Windenservo für die Basis zu verwenden, die sich nur um 90 Grad drehen müsste?

Ich habe gelesen, dass Windenservos nicht so präzise sind, aber solange das Servo innerhalb von 1-3 Grad von dem ist, was es sein sollte, ist das für mich in Ordnung.

Können Sie dem Servo auch sagen, dass es sich wie ein normales Servo auf 0 Grad oder 35 oder 87 Grad drehen soll, oder ist es wie ein Servo mit kontinuierlicher Drehung, bei dem es sich weiterdreht, bis es das Ende seiner Drehung erreicht, und das Schreiben von 100 gegenüber 180 einfach die Geschwindigkeit steuert ?

Vielen Dank für Ihre Hilfe.

Servomotoren für Segelwinden sind nicht dasselbe wie solche mit kontinuierlicher Rotation. Stattdessen gibt es sie in verschiedenen Rotationswerten, dh Servo mit 3,5 Umdrehungen oder 5 Umdrehungen. Das bedeutet, dass eine Impulsdauer von beispielsweise 70% links oder rechts eine bestimmte Anzahl von Umdrehungen des Servos verursachen würde.
@AnindoGhosh Können Sie die genaue Position des Servos einstellen oder sagt das Schreiben (100) ihm einfach die Geschwindigkeit, mit der es sich in diese Richtung drehen soll?
Es ist positionell, genau wie herkömmliche Servos. Nicht drehzahlgeregelt.

Antworten (1)

Ein Segelwindenservo ist nicht ideal , um etwas anzutreiben, das sich nur um 90 Grad drehen muss: Das Windenservo ist so konzipiert, dass es eine feste Anzahl von Drehungen von der maximalen bis zur minimalen "Winkel" -Einstellung bietet. Dazu später mehr.

Zur Identifizierung eines geeigneten Servomotors:

  • Definieren Sie Drehmomentspezifikationen, um die Suche einzugrenzen
  • Suchen Sie nach Servos, die alle Metallgetriebe angeben: Dieses hier bietet beispielsweise ein Drehmoment von über 15 KG/cm.
  • Bevorzugen Sie bürstenlose DC-Servomotoren: Sie sind im Allgemeinen effizienter, erzeugen weniger EMI und sind oft auch weniger akustisch laut.
  • Servomotoren, die mit Metalllagern oder noch besser mit Doppelmetalllagern ausgestattet sind, können mehr Belastungen außerhalb der Rotationsebene standhalten und halten im Allgemeinen unter Last länger. Dies kann je nach Roboterarmdesign ein Problem sein oder auch nicht.
  • Wenn die Drehmomentanforderungen von Hobby-Servos nicht erfüllt werden, schauen Sie sich industrielle Servomotoren an, sowohl DC als auch AC, die für eine Reihe von Leistungs- / Drehmomentwerten zu finden sind.
  • Eine Alternative ist der Einsatz eines Schrittmotors, ggf. mit Untersetzung, wenn auf die Einfachheit der Servosteuerung verzichtet werden kann.

Eine Alternative ist die mechanische Drehmomentvervielfachung entweder mit einem Schrittmotor oder einem herkömmlichen Servomotor, beispielsweise durch interne Planetengetriebe:

Interne Planetengetriebe ( Quelle und Zusatzinformationen )


Ein Segelwindenservo nimmt die gleichen Pulsdauermodulationssignale zur Servosteuerung wie herkömmliche Hobbyservos, ist jedoch so ausgelegt, dass eine "volle" Durchquerung mehrere vollständige Umdrehungen umfasst.

Vergleicht man zum Beispiel ein +/- 90 Grad (dh 180 Grad) Servo mit einem Segelwindenservo mit 3,5 Umdrehungen, würde ein Signal von ~ 1250 Millisekunden Impulsen, dh 50 % Linksdrehung, bei einem normalen Servo etwa -45 Grad erreichen, und rund 315 Grad Drehung auf der Segelwinde, knapp vor dem Vollkreis.

Wenn das Steuersignal ein 2000-Millisekunden-Impuls wäre, typischerweise "maximal im Uhrzeigersinn", würde sich das reguläre Servo auf +90 drehen, während sich die Segelwinde mit 1,75 Umdrehungen drehen würde, fast zwei volle Kreise.

Mit dieser proportionalen Zunahme der Winkeldrehung geht die entsprechende Abnahme der Präzision einher: Wenn das hypothetische reguläre Servo oben in 1-Grad-Schritten präzise gesteuert werden könnte, würde die Präzision des Segelwindenservos proportional nur 7-Grad-Schritte betragen.


Die Situation " Schreiben von 100 vs. 180 steuert einfach die Geschwindigkeit " gilt für Servos mit kontinuierlicher Drehung , nicht für Segelwindenservos. Bei einem CR-Servo wurde im Wesentlichen der Rotationssensor (normalerweise ein Potentiometer) getrennt, sodass der Controller im Inneren als reine Richtungs- und Geschwindigkeitssteuerung fungiert.